Spiritual Direction is the practice of listening with another in a prayerful relationship in order to more clearly hear and experience the movement of God in one’s life.
It is a way of extending a sustaining, welcoming environment within a one-on-one relationship, and is a dynamic process where one can listen to self in order to reflect on life's questions in light of our Gospel call.

whole purpose of Spiritual Direction is to penetrate beneath the surface of a person's life, to get behind the facade of conventional gestures and attitudes which one presents to the world, and to bring out one's inner spiritual freedom, one's inmost trust...the likeness of Christ in one's soul.” Thomas Merton
